Composers : Martha Woods
Martha Woods is a composer and multi-instrumentalist from Cornwall. Having grown up playing and dancing with traditional Cornish dance team, Tan Ha Dowr, and writing songs for her band, The Woodcarts, she went on to study on the Folk and Traditional Music degree at Newcastle University (including a year at the University of Limerick). She enjoys writing tunes and songs for a range of different settings and combining elements of folk and traditional music with more contemporary genres.
